A vibrant and refreshing pasta salad, bursting with the zesty flavor of peppercorn ranch and crisp, colorful vegetables. Perfect as a light lunch, a simple dinner, or a crowd-pleasing side dish for your next gathering.

Recipe View Bring a large pot of generously salted water to a rolling boil. (5 minutes)

Image Step 02
02 Step

Recipe View Add the rotini pasta and cook according to package directions, or until al dente. (8-10 minutes)

Image Step 03
03 Step

Recipe View While the pasta is cooking, prepare an ice bath.

Image Step 04
04 Step

Recipe View Drain the pasta immediately and plunge it into the ice bath to stop the cooking process and maintain a firm texture. (2 minutes)

Image Step 05
05 Step

Recipe View Once the pasta is cooled, drain it thoroughly and transfer it to a large mixing bowl.

Image Step 06
06 Step

Recipe View Add the sliced baby carrots, broccoli florets, red onion, cauliflower, and green bell pepper to the bowl with the pasta.

Image Step 07
07 Step

Recipe View Pour the peppercorn Ranch dressing over the pasta and vegetables. Gently toss to coat evenly, ensuring all ingredients are well combined. (2 minutes)

Image Step 08
08 Step

Recipe View Cover the bowl tightly with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 2 hours, or preferably overnight, to allow the flavors to meld and intensify. (120 minutes)

Image Step 09
09 Step

Recipe View Before serving, give the pasta salad a gentle toss to redistribute the dressing. Garnish with freshly cracked black pepper, if desired.

For a creamier salad, add a dollop of sour cream or Greek yogurt to the dressing.
If you prefer a sweeter flavor, try adding a handful of dried cranberries or raisins.
To add protein, consider incorporating grilled chicken, chickpeas, or crumbled feta cheese.
For best results, use a high-quality peppercorn Ranch dressing. The flavor of the dressing will significantly impact the overall taste of the salad.
Be careful not to overcook the pasta. Al dente pasta will hold its shape better and provide a more pleasant texture in the salad.
If you're short on time, you can use pre-cut vegetables.
